ABSTRACT
Objective To explore the possibility of anal preserving after total mesorectal excision combined with stapling technique in radical resection of low rectal cancers. Methods We retrospectively summarized the data of 93 cases of low rectal cancer treated by radical resection and anal preservation, and made specific assessment of post operative rectal sensation and anal function. Results All of the cases were free of cancer invasion of the distal margin of resected bowel.The rate of local recurrence at 2 years after operation was 5.3 %, and 93.5% of patients had good rectal sensation and anal function. Conclusions Anal preserving operation for low rectal cancers using total mesorectal excision combined with stepling technique can improve the postoperative quality of life, and is safe and feasible.
